Power Bomb Tank Hidden By Mecha Ridley
When you're in the room before you have to shoot the top of a block, run in to the room with the block and turn around. Shoot at the door and run and don't stop. When you reach around the place where you have to jump, run and jump with the speed booster and jump and the floor should break. Then, space jump across the room, but be careful! There are lasers, and if you hit one, then you have to go to another room again and do it all over again. Then, at the end of it, power bomb the floor or space jump, or do what ever you have to do to get it, and then you have another 5 power bombs! Pretty sweet huh? Try it. Sooner or later you will get it.

All Tanks, And Pick-ups (Not Infinite)
This is on the basis that "Metroid" has already been unlocked. Go to "Options" on the main page. Select "Original Metroid", and press Start when the title screen comes up. Press select, and then Start. Type "JUSTIN BAILEY ------ ------". Note: Do not use the numbers, and you can't type the apostrophes, don't worry about spacing: it's every six spaces. Type the dashes which is located in the bottom right. When done, press start, and you will begin in Norfair, on the Elevator, with a suit-less Samus, with Wave Beam, 255 Missiles, and 30 energy units. You have all the tanks, and pick-ups, but it is not infinite.

Invincibility
Enter "NARPAS SWORD0 000000 000000" as a password. This allows you to start with everything and invincibility. The Bosses are not defeated, and you can play the game normally, but invincible.

With Or Without The Long Beam
You can get the long beam to get to the east part of Brinstar, but there's a way in which you don't need the long beam. Only do this if your pretty good at the game. Go to where the door between the two sides of Brinstar is. Go onto the ground above it and shoot down. You'll blast through a secret passage leading to the door.
